Loretta D Latimore
Miami, FL- Miami, FL + 1 more
More about Loretta D Latimore
Summary
- Full Name
- Loretta D Latimore
- Used to Live in:
Phones and Addresses
-
Miami, FL
-
Miami, FL145 Ne 78Th St Apt 1209 Miami, FL 33138